A one of them days outfit usually signals a deliberately low-effort or muted look chosen to signal a tough, bored, or emotionally drained mood. The phrase borrows from casual speech where people say “it’s one of those days” to acknowledge fatigue, frustration, or apathy, and the clothing follows that vibe. Rather than aiming for polished or conspicuous style, a one of them days outfit leans toward softness, simplicity, and comfort. This evergreen explainer unpacks how the expression is used, what visual cues people commonly read into the look, and how to assemble clothes that fit the mood without sacrificing basic coherence.
Defining the Phrase and Its Fashion Use
The expression “one of them days” functions as shorthand for any day when mental or emotional resources feel limited. In fashion talk, it describes an outfit that mirrors that limited bandwidth—often understated, slightly rumpled, or intentionally neutral. Unlike fashion-forward looks built to stand out, a one of them days outfit is curated to feel easy and unobtrusive. It is not inherently negative; rather, it is a practical response to the reality that not every day calls for sharp tailoring or high-gloss styling. The look tends to prioritize comfort, familiarity, and a quiet aesthetic that signals self-protection or simple realism.
Visual Language and Common Signals
Even without a strict definition, people tend to read certain visual signals when they label an outfit as a one of them days outfit. These signals don’t operate like hard rules, but they show how the phrase is commonly understood in style conversations.
Neutral or Muted Color Range
Expect a narrowed palette—grays, beiges, off-whites, navy, or faded blacks—rather than bright blocks of color.
Soft or Relaxed Fit
Garments sit loosely or with a gently draped silhouette, avoiding tight tailoring or structured shapes.
Minimal Styling or Accessorizing
Fewer accessories, no bold logos, and restrained layering suggest a stripped-down approach.
Textured, Comfortable Fabrics
Knits, jersey, cotton, and unstructured materials replace shiny suiting or dressy finishes.

Practical Wardrobe Building for This Mood
Assembling a one of them days outfit becomes straightforward once you define boundaries instead of blank-canvas freedom. Choose a small set of pieces that communicate softness and simplicity without looking like you dressed in the dark. Aim for combinations that preserve a basic level of neatness so the outfit reads as intentional rather than accidental.
Core Upper-Body Options
- Slouchy knit tees or lightweight long-sleeve tees in muted shades
- Oversized button-downs worn open or half-tucked
- Soft cotton or merino crewnecks that resist pilling
Foundational Bottoms
- Straight or relaxed jeans in mid-to-dark washes
- Neutral chinos or tapered joggers with a slightly structured leg
- Linen-blend trousers in gray or oatmeal for softer weather
Outerwear and Layering
- Unstructured denim or cotton jackets
- Minimalist bomber or chore-style jackets in neutral tones
- Lightweight cardigans and zip hoodies for texture
Footwear and Practical Details
- Low-profile sneakers or simple leather sneakers
- Comfortable boots with clean lines
- Slip-on shoes that align with weather and terrain
Context, Tone, and Communication
Because the phrase is conversational, a one of them days outfit communicates something beyond the clothing itself. It can function as a low-key boundary, suggesting limited bandwidth for social performance. At work, a softened version of the look—neat relaxed trousers, a restrained knit, and polished sneakers—can preserve professionalism while honoring the mood. In social settings, the same palette and relaxed fit read as approachable rather than disengaged, provided grooming details like hair and facial care remain intentional. The look is versatile, but clarity of context helps avoid misreading.
Variations Across Gender and Personal Style
There is no single correct way to execute a one of them days outfit, because the phrase adapts to different wardrobes and identities. Feminine-coded presentations might include soft tees, relaxed knit dresses, or slightly slouchy blazers paired with trainers. Masculine-coded presentations often lean on oxford shirts worn open, boxy hoodies, and tapered chinos. Across aesthetics, the consistent thread is a tempered level of formality, a neutral palette, and fabrics that feel gentle against the skin. Personal history and cultural context also shape how people interpret and perform this mood through clothing, and those differences are meaningful to acknowledge.
